Benjamin Loeb is a GRAMMY®-nominated conductor, and accomplished pianist. He has soloed with the Boston Pops Orchestra with Alan Gilbert and has also collaborated with JoAnn Falletta, Carl St. Clair, and Yo-Yo Ma. This season, he conducted the Dallas Symphony Orchestra and Chorus in a sold-out performance of Murry Sidlin’s Defiant Requiem: Verdi at Terezin, as well as performances and recordings throughout Eastern Europe with the Lviv National Philharmonic Orchestra, the North Bohemian Opera Ballet Orchestra, and the Bohuslav Martinu Philharmonic. Loeb toured Argentina and Uruguay as US State Department Artistic Ambassador and founded and runs the International Conducting Workshop and Festival, one of the most successful training seminars for orchestra conductors. He holds degrees from Harvard University, the Curtis Institute, The Juilliard School, and the Peabody. |
